To study the microscopic electronic and magnetic interactions in the substoichiometric iron chalcogenide FeSe1-x which is observed to superconduct at x approximate to 1/8 up to T-c = 27 K, we use first principles methods to study the Se vacancy in this nearly magnetic FeSe system. The vacancy forms a ferrimagnetic cluster of eight Fe atoms, which for the ordered x = 1/8 alloy leads to half-metallic conduction. Similar magnetic clusters are obtained for FeTe1-x and for BaFe2As2 with an As vacancy although neither of these are half-metallic. Based on fixed spin-density results, we suggest the low-energy excitations in FeSe1-x are antiparamagnonlike with short correlation length.
